Background
Predicted to enable calcium ion binding activity; carbohydrate binding activity; and hyaluronic acid binding activity. Involved in synapse maturation. Acts upstream of or within hippocampus development. Located in perineuronal net. Is active in glutamatergic synapse. Is expressed in several structures, including brain; genitourinary system; lower jaw; sensory organ; and spinal cord.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in high grade glioma. Orthologous to human BCAN (brevican).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Feb 2025]
